"Should I call them?" she vocalized her thoughts.

"Do you want to? Sure, just go ahead, they're your parents!" he said, flippantly.

Stacy groaned in frustration.

"No, you don't understand. I can't 'just go ahead'. They told me never to call them out of the blue." Stacy explained; it was an impossibility, the very idea terrified her. "They call me."

He gave her that look again. She understood it a little better this time. He looked vaguely horrified, but her parents weren't like that, they were just... particular. She felt the need to defend them, to explain. She tried to build her argument, line up the words that normally served her so well, but they ran in opposite directions when she tried. Why was this so difficult to articulate?

"Look, I'm not going to pretend to understand." Tristan said. "I get it, a bit. You want to be a good girl..."

He continued talking but she didn't hear him as a breath of pleasure lifted her for a moment. The pressure lifted and she could think again. It was just what she'd needed. Why did Tristan saying that affect her so?

"... or a neighbor, even a cleaner." he finished.

"Aha! You're a genius!" Stacy exclaimed.

Without thinking, she lifted her mouth to his, and kissed him. His lips were rough, a man's lips, firm and cracked. She could taste him, a flavor of salt and lemon that embedded itself deep in her memory. His chin was slightly spiky. Her mind spun, and she lost herself in him for a moment. Far too long. This felt good, too good. He smelled clean and masculine. She almost put one hand on his jaw but managed to stop herself just in time. Fuck, this was their first kiss, right? That was a mistake. He'd get the wrong idea. She had to stop. She barely knew him outside of these... diversions. He definitely wasn't on the approved partner list. Quickly, she broke the kiss.

Ignoring his enquiring look, she turned her attention back to her phone. Within seconds she'd found the contact she was looking for and called the number. They picked up before the first ring.

"Stacy here. Carlisle, can you tell me what's going on?" she asked.

Tristan looked at her enquiringly. Rather than scold him for nosiness, for some reason she felt the urge to explain. 'Butler' she mouthed to him. That would have to do, she had to pay attention.

"Ah, the famous young mistress." an airy British accent exclaimed. "It is a distinct pleasure to hear from you. You've been quite the topic of conversation over here tonight."

"Me?!" she exclaimed. "What do you mean?"

Alarm froze all warm feelings from her mind. If her parents were discussing her, they were okay. That was scant relief; the only time they spoke positively of her was to others. In private, any mention of her was uniformly bad - they didn't bother to keep up appearances for the butler. Maybe it would have been better if one of them had been sick. No Stacy, never think that. They're her parents and just wanted her to succeed. They had a lot on their plates what with the woes of the family's hereditary businesses. Of course they loved her.

"I very much regret to inform you that your parents had the foresight to swear me to secrecy." he sighed. "Admittedly a rather poor time for them to remember I exist beyond chores. I am sorry, mistress." he said sadly.

Stacy's mind leapt in terror. Mentally she ran around in circles screaming. They'd asked him to keep it a secret? This was bad, very bad. Stress descended, pressing down on her shoulders. Making it difficult to breathe. What could it be? The sword hanging over her head was worse than the shouting which would surely come next. But there was no way to bring it forward, it would be done on their schedule, or... well, there was never any other alternative.

"Could you... could you advise me Carlisle?" she asked, trying to think of a way around it. "As you did when I was a girl?"

"I'm afraid not, mistress. But now we're speaking, may I tell you a little story?" he asked, oddly.

Carlisle had never shared any stories of his own life with her.

"Of course." she croaked.

"Thank you, mistress. When I was a few years younger than you, my father sat me on his knee and asked me what I wanted to do with my life. I was about to finish my O-levels and he told me it was high time I devoted myself body and soul to a profession, and let no man tear me from it. I realised he was right. I told him I wanted to be just like him, a gentleman's gentleman, if you will. It was my choice. And I have never regretted it. It is my calling. We should all take time in our lives to consider our calling."

"That - what?" Stacy sputtered in confusion. "Couldn't you just..."

"I look forward to your upcoming visit." he said, interrupting her.

"My visit? I wasn't planning..." she said, mystified.

"Very good." Carlisle said, in a very different tone.

Over the line she heard a door crash into a wall.

"Hey butler!" her father's voice shouted in the background. "Who the hell are you talking to? Get back to work! Why must I be surrounded by incompetents?"

"Sadly that particular feeling is familiar to me also, sir." Carlisle said without a trace of sympathy. "Will..."

The line was cut off abruptly. Her father had sounded livid, absolutely raging. It felt like she had a knife on her chest. She wheezed a couple of breaths, her hand over her heart.

Tristan's arms held her tight, held her together. An eternity later he spoke.

"Let me get you back to your dorm." Tristan said, helping her to her feet.
